You bought the thing. And then immediately, before you even got home, the spiral started. The mental math, the second-guessing, the low-grade shame sitting in your chest for the rest of the day. Sound familiar? Most women entrepreneurs know this feeling better than they'd like to admit -- and almost none of us talk about it out loud.
The guilt isn't about the amount. A $6 coffee can wreck your whole afternoon just as fast as a $600 investment can. The spiral has nothing to do with the number on the receipt and everything to do with the energy you spent that money WITH and whether you actually feel safe having it in the first place.
This episode is the one I wish someone had handed me years ago. We're going into the energetics of money, what it actually means to cultivate safety with it, and the allocation system that quietly changed everything about how I spend, save, and receive. No guilt spiral required.
What we're covering:
Why safety is the real foundation of your money relationship -- and how to start building it from the inside out
The difference between spending from love and trust versus fear and lack (and how to tell which one is running the show)
How to think about the longevity of a purchase instead of just the price tag -- and why that reframe is everything
The allocation system that gives you total clarity so you can spend with ease and actually enjoy it

"Mom, what's for dinner? When is practice? Where are my socks? Can you help me with this?"
And every single question pulls you out of flow, fragments your attention, and reminds you that you're the household CEO even when you're trying to run your actual business.
You love your family. You love being the leader. But you also know there's a better way - one where systems do the heavy lifting so you're not constantly on call to direct everyone. Where your mental bandwidth is freed up for the work that actually lights you up. Where your daughter learns responsibility and your partner knows what's happening without you having to manage every detail.
This episode breaks down the three core systems I use in my household: a communication board that acts as our family cockpit, a jobs chart that teaches my daughter work ethic and money management, and a 4-jar system that's building her financial literacy from the ground up. These aren't just "mom hacks" - they're business tools that create the space you need to actually do your work.
What we're covering:
The communication board system (weekly schedule, meal plan, grocery list, to-dos - all in one visible place)
Jobs chart for kids (daily responsibilities, paid jobs, invoice system, and why I call them "jobs" not "chores")
4-jar money management (spending, savings, investing, bills - teaching financial literacy early)
Why implementing systems reduces resentment and creates equality in your household
